Transaction 17bbe936de443395cdbdbefde65742a27958c8699a61d93779d855e49ca5a483
1 Input
1 Output
-
17bbe936de443395cdbdbefde65742a27958c8699a61d93779d855e49ca5a483:0
- value
- 9235797
- script pubkey
- OP_0 OP_PUSHBYTES_20 16b5cd75adce00f862cd486ce8331ad04c65a810
- address
- bc1qz66u6addecq0sckdfpkwsvc66pxxt2qsmgvduq